REGULAR MEETING AUGUST 14 1972 <br />RESOLUTION NO. 323 -72 - ATTACHMENTS <br />" July 19, 1972 " <br />Mr. Frank Miles, President <br />Area Plan Commission <br />County -City Building <br />South Bend, Indiana <br />Dear Mr. Miles: <br />Our Commission has an application from International Bakers Services, Inc. of South <br />Bend, Indiana for an industrial revenue bond issue of $350,000 to enable them to build <br />a building on land contiguous to Airport Industrial Park - Phase III facing the Toll <br />Road with an entrance on Cleveland Road. <br />This building would house this well -known international business in this area and <br />benefit the community through increased employment with the expansion plans. The <br />company presently employs twelve people and expects to double this number in the near <br />future, and more later. <br />The planned building would not contribute to pollution, cause any unusual hazards, <br />nor be an increased burden to the police or fire department. The utility expansion <br />in Airport Industrial Park - III will service this building also. <br />The increased employment would be from people already living in the area and therefore <br />be of no additional burden to the school system. The planned building would be an <br />addition to our tax base and of benefit to the tax revenues, and therefore the school <br />system. <br />In accordance with the provisions of the Industrial Development Act, State of Indiana, <br />it is necessary for us to secure approval from the area plan commission having juris- <br />diction of the area in which the project is to be built. <br />We would appreciate your approval in the near future. <br />Cordially, <br />Karl G.
